A family property, Domaine Grand Nicolet saw its first vines planted in 1875. Today, the property covers about 31 hectares of vines, including some old vines in Sablet (planted on sandy and limestone soils) and and Rasteau (with clay and blue marl soils) enabeling for more full-bodied and powerful wines. The average age of the vine is 45 years, with some Grenache of more than 90 years old.

Winemaking
Hand-picked in 15 kg crates. 100% de-stemming. De-stemming and punching down. Temperature control. Vatting for 21 days. When the balance between alcohol and acidity is reached
acidity, i.e. around 90g of sugars/litre, 10% wine alcohol is added at of wine alcohol at 96° is added to stop fermentation.
Ageing
Aged in concrete vats for 8 months.
Varietal
Grenache noir : 100%
